New Canaan and Staples are places in Connecticut. This page compares them across population, income, housing, education, commuting, and how each has changed since 2019.

New Canaan has the higher population (7,032 vs 6,985 in Staples). Staples has the higher median household income ($218,365 vs $163,355 in New Canaan). Staples has the higher median home value ($1,202,800 vs $1,115,600 in New Canaan).
